Sheff Wed 1 Arsenal 0

FOOTBALL - PAUL SHAW (ARSENAL) TIGHTLY MARKED BY JON NEWSOME (20) (SHEFF.WED.). SHEFFIELD WEDNESDAY 1 ARSENAL 0, FA PREMIERSHIP, 8/4/1996. CREDIT : COLORSPORT / ANDREW COWIE

Colorsport Images are an ever-expanding library providing extensive coverage of all aspects of sport including Olympics since 1972 and football since 1881
